Question:

a. The following questions refer to a generic Windows file system:

i) Describe what happens when you high-level format a floppy disk?
ii) What is the maximum size of a primary partition formatted under FAT16?
iii) Give three advantages of using NTFS over FAT32.
iv) How is a cluster different from a sector in relation to a hard disk?

b. What are the implications of choosing between a workgroup and a domain when configuring network parameters in Windows XP? Can two hosts communicate if they are on the same network but have different workgroup names?

What is a general graph? A tree structure where links can go from one branch to a node earlier in the similar branch or other branch, allowing cycles.
